Old Church Slavonic
Etymology
Inherited from Proto-Slavic *pisьmo.
Noun
писмѧ • (pismę) n
- letter (grapheme)

- writing
- from Vita Constantini, 1300310-1300330:
на нѥм же соуть писмена жидовꙿскꙑ и самарѣнꙿскꙑ гранꙑ написанꙑ, ихꙿже не можаше никтоже ни прочисти ни сказати.- On it were inscribed words in Hebrew and Samaritan letters which none were able to read or explain.
